Makeup for dark hair and dark eyes

What are the secrets of this care? There are several important rules, if followed, you will always look beautiful and presentable.

  • Always use makeup only on clean skin. Wash your face with a cleanser and use toner or lotion a few hours before your event.
  • You always need to highlight only one element in the face. If you are making your eyes bright, then you should leave the lips as natural as possible. The only exceptions are the evening make-up.
  • Don't use more than three shades for your eye makeup. Otherwise, you will look vulgar and more like a clown.
  • Try to hide obvious facial imperfections. To do this, use a concealer, powder and pencils.
  • Your makeup should ideally complement the overall one.That is why it is worth considering the image before you start applying the make-up.

Step one: preparing the skin for painting

In addition to cleansing the face, this type of make-up requires careful preparation of the work area. You will need some scrap materials and decorative cosmetics. Stock up on foundation, concealer and powder. Also prepare brown and black pencils, matching eye shadow, lipstick and blush.

After cleansing the skin, apply a small amount of day cream on it. Let this structure absorb thoroughly. Then take a close look at your skin. Does it have imperfections, redness and pimples? They must be eliminated at this stage. Take the concealer in your hands and apply it in spots on the desired areas. If the flaw is dark or red, then you should use a greenish color. It is this shade that can perfectly hide unnecessary nuances. Next, you need to slightly shade the applied points and start using the foundation.

Remember that during the daytime, you should give preference to a matte and transparent shade that best suits your skin color. If you have blue eyes (dark hair), makeup can be done without this step. However, for brown-eyed girls, the tonal base is an indispensable tool for creating a harmonious image. At night and in the evening, make-up can be done with a denser pearlescent tonal powder or cream. Blend the transitions thoroughly. The minimum amount of this material should be on the forehead, nose and chin.

Step two: eyebrow shaping

Make-up for dark hair and dark eyes involves the mandatory selection of the area above the eyes. If you are preparing a daytime look, then you can use a brown or lead pencil. Emphasize the brow area and paint in the missing hairs. Evening makeup allows you to use a black pencil for this.

Step three: using shadows

Before proceeding with this point, it is worth choosing the right paints. If you are creating a daytime look, then you should give preference to a matte, transparent one. When applying an evening make-up, you can use more. Brunettes with dark hair are perfect for blue, purple, pink and black shades. Also, do not forget about the transparent mother-of-pearl, which can add zest to every shade of shadows.

The application of paints to the eyelid area can be vertical or horizontal. If you are using a solid color, then you can first draw a neat arrow. The lower eyelids should be left without makeup at all during the daytime, especially if your work requires a strict style. In the evening, the lower eyelid can be highlighted with the help or shadows.

Step five: lipstick

This makeup should be designed to complement the overall look. For a daytime make-up, you should choose soft, pastel and matte shades. You can do without lip gloss altogether. In the evening, you can give preference to red, purple or They will emphasize the sensuality of your lips and make them attractive.

When applying bright colors, you should use a pencil of the same tone to indicate the outline. This technique will allow the makeup to hold for a longer time and not spread.
